Data Transfer Speeds

One of the first things I consider is the data transfer speed. The USB 3.2 Gen 1 standard offers speeds up to 5 Gbps, which is significantly faster than USB 2.0’s maximum of 480 Mbps. This speed difference can greatly enhance my experience when transferring large files or using data-intensive peripherals. I always look for specifications that highlight these speeds.
